Hardware for this model

At least 24 GB of VRAM is needed just to hold the smallest weights (18.1 GB). The complete requirement is higher and not modelled yet.

  • Smallest catalogued artifact: 18.1 GB of weights (Q4_K_M).
  • A GPU with at least 24 GB of VRAM holds those weights.
  • Not modelled yet: attention layers only: recurrent state not included.
